Winter Months Climate Considerations
When winter season rolls in, how ready is your roof covering for the challenges it brings? Snow, ice, and freezing temperatures can take a toll on your roof's stability.
Initially, look for any existing damage prior to the cool sets in. Try to find missing roof shingles, fractures, or leaks; attending to these concerns now can conserve you from pricey repair services later.
Next, think about the weight of snow. Accumulation can cause drooping or perhaps architectural failing. If you stay in a region prone to hefty snowfall, it's wise to invest in a roof rake. Consistently clearing snow off your roofing helps stop these problems.
After that, focus on your rain gutters. Stopped up rain gutters can result in ice dams, causing water to back up and potentially permeate right into your home. Ensure your gutters are clean and free of particles to promote correct drain.
Last but not least, examine your attic for proper insulation and air flow. A well-insulated attic helps prevent warm loss, lowering the opportunities of ice development on your roof.

Begin by looking for any type of noticeable damages, like missing out on tiles or cracked floor tiles. If you detect any kind of issues, resolve them without delay to prevent leakages.
Next off, remove debris, such as leaves and branches, that may have built up on your roof covering and in your rain gutters.
Clogged gutters can lead to water merging, which can damage your roof covering and home's foundation. Cleansing them out will assist route water flow and safeguard your home.
Examine your roof's blinking and seals around smokeshafts and vents. If they look worn or harmed, re-caulking might be needed to preserve a leak-proof seal.
Lastly, take into consideration arranging an expert assessment. An expert can detect prospective concerns you could miss out on and use referrals tailored to your roof type.
Summer and Autumn Preparations
As the summer season sunlight blazes and leaves start to change, it's crucial to prepare your roof for the future months.
Begin by checking your roof for any damages brought on by the intense sunlight or storms. Search for fractured shingles, loose floor tiles, or any type of indicators of wear. Do not neglect to examine your seamless gutters; they need to be free from debris to ensure correct drain during fall rainfalls.
Next, think about applying a safety finish to your roofing system. This can help reflect the sunlight's rays, safeguarding your tiles from UV damage.
If flooring installation contractor have trees near your home, trim back branches that might drop or rub against your roofing in tornados.
As loss techniques, watch on the fallen leaves. Buildup can trap wetness, bring about mold and rot. On a regular basis removing your roofing and gutters will assist stop these issues.
